Large 4" Edmontosaurus Phalanx (Toe Bone)

This is a large Phalanx (toe) bone from the hadrosaur Edmontosaurus annectens. It's about 4 inches tall and weights over a pound. It is from the Upper Cretaceous, Hell Creek Formation.

The bone comes from a well known private quarry in Butte County, Montana which was discovered back in the 1980's It represents a river channel deposit and consists of 2 meets worth of sandstone and gravel. Teeth and other bone material being swept down the river 66 million years ago would have been deposited here. the Hell Creek Formation represents a sub-tropical floodplain which would have been similar to coastal, modern-day Louisiana.
